AYA NEW ARTIST MEMBERS — EDITION 6
The American Young Artists Association introduces Edition 6 of its New Artist Members, welcoming a select group of artists whose work reflects both technical discipline and a clear artistic voice. Each addition is made through a focused curatorial process, emphasizing not only accomplishment, but direction, intention, and the ability to engage meaningfully with contemporary audiences.
This cohort brings together artists working across performance and interdisciplinary practices, unified by a strong sense of narrative and expression. Whether rooted in classical tradition or shaped by more fluid, cross-genre approaches, their work reflects a shared understanding that artistry extends beyond execution into communication. Technique serves as a foundation, but it is their interpretive depth and individuality that define this group.
As part of the AYA community, these artists enter a broader ecosystem centered on collaboration and long-term development. Through curated performances, partnerships, and cross-disciplinary projects, Edition 6 members will engage with both audiences and fellow artists in ways that encourage exchange, experimentation, and new forms of creative dialogue.
This edition continues AYA’s commitment to building a community grounded in clarity and substance. Rather than focusing on scale, the organization remains dedicated to thoughtful expansion, supporting artists whose work carries both immediate impact and lasting potential. Edition 6 stands as a continuation of that vision, marking another step in shaping a refined and forward-looking artistic network.
